John 19:14-18

14 It was about noon on the day when they prepared the Passover meal.

Pilate said to the Jews, ‘Here is your king!’

15 But they shouted, ‘Take him away! Take him away! Kill him on a cross!’

Pilate asked them, ‘Do you want me to kill your king on a cross?’

The leaders of the priests answered, ‘Caesar is the only ruler that we call king.’

16 Then Pilate gave Jesus to them, so that they could kill him on a cross.

Soldiers fix Jesus to a cross

The soldiers took hold of Jesus. 17 He was carrying the cross on which they would kill him. He went out to the place called ‘The Place of the Skull’. This place is called ‘Golgotha’ in the Jewish language.

19:17The place is also called Calvary.

18 When they arrived there, the soldiers fixed Jesus to the cross. They put two other men on crosses near to him. They were on each side of him and Jesus was between them.
